Death of Dhammachari Kushalapriya

From Order Connection on Mon, 12 Oct, 2020 - 12:37

Dear Order Members,

It is sad to inform you that Dhammachari Kushalapriya (Mumbai) passed away yesterday afternoon around 3.45pm. He was 77 years old. For the last few months he was not in good health because of his old age and he was recently hospitalised for his leg fracture treatment.

His ordination took place in April 2004 at the Bhaja retreat centre; Adityabodhi was his private preceptor and the public ordination ceremony was conducted by Dhammachari Sudarshan. He received the Shakyamuni Sadhana at ordination.

If your website is showing to some as 'unsafe'...

From Triratna Resources on Thu, 8 Oct, 2020 - 09:53

This from Dhammamegha:

We have had some trouble at Windhorse Publications earlier this year where access to the site was blocked for potential users. It turned out that there was a Vodafone algorithm that was wrongly applied to us. This applied to both Vodafone contracts and broadband supplied by them, including by third parties. Vodaphone’s algorithm made the judgement that the site contained indecent or inappropriate material.
